Sewer Backup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water damage from a clogged toilet Yes No DIY cleanup is usually enough for small water damage.
Large water damage from a sewer backup No Yes Professional equipment and expertise are needed to safely and efficiently remove water and dry the affected area.
Water damage during heavy rainfall No Yes Professional help is needed to prevent further damage and potential health hazards.
Sewer line backup after construction or renovation No Yes Professional help is needed to identify and repair any issues with the sewer line.
Musty odors or slow drains No Yes Professional help is needed to identify and repair any issues with the sewer line.

Common Questions About Sewer Backup Water Removal

Q: What causes sewer backups?

A: Sewer backups can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ged drains, tree roots, and heavy rainfall. Our team can help identify the source of the issue and develop a plan to prevent future backups.
